Wow, what a beauty. Decanted for 2 hours, intensely aromatic, precise and energetic showing black raspberries, candied red cherries, flowers, hints of orange peel and packed with minerals. Finishes with exceptional length. The tannins are present and firm but the wine’s superb balance along with the combination of Fourrier’s style and the ripe vintage make it in a wonderful place now and with a certainty to improve with age. — 6 years ago
Can’t get stop going after ‘15 Burgundy. Here, from one of region’s elite and from the fabulous Combe aux Moines vineyard, deeply flavored and beautifully perfumed, ripe black cherries, red raspberry, exotic spices and damp earth. The texture is luxurious and supple and the finish is long and seductive. 🔥 — 7 years ago

First thing I notice is the golden color. Very floral, white flowers, can smell the green stem of a flower. Smells very hot, with mineral/shell/slate. Also smells sweet, honey suckle, and butterscotch. Must be oaked at least slightly. Tastes hot, high acidity, citrus notes/grapefruit. Very juicy as well, in guava, pineapple, tropical fruits for sure, and green grapes. Also low mouth feel, aka thin, but it is refreshing. I've never tried either of these grapes and really enjoy it. Pretty complex and tasty! — 9 years ago
